Straight pipes will give you the greatest volume and they also have a real nasty crack when you rack the throttle. No performance lost at all....just displaced performance. Straight pipes will put all of your power and torque somewhere above 4000 rpm. That is good because the engine will naturally make more noise at higher RPM anyway so riding in the power range will make more noise all the time..
